Residents at an Isle of Wight care home recently enjoyed a visit to the annual Jigsaw Puzzle Festival - a highlight of the summer for many.

Held every August, this popular event is organised by dedicated volunteers from St James’s Church, becoming a cherished tradition in East Cowes.

For the residents at Orchard House in Newport, the visit was a highlight of the summer, providing both entertainment and a chance to connect with the local community.

The festival features a wide range of jigsaw puzzles, offering something for everyone, from beginners to seasoned puzzle enthusiasts.

Katie Schlepp, head of lifestyle at Orchard House, said: “Our residents absolutely love puzzles, so visiting the Jigsaw Puzzle Festival was a must for us.

“The variety of puzzles on display was incredible, and we are grateful to the volunteers at St James’s Church for organising such a wonderful event. 

“It brought so much joy to our residents.”
